A sukiya-style home is a traditional Japanese architectural form characterized by refined simplicity, the use of natural materials, and a seamless integration between indoor living spaces and the surrounding landscape. Originally derived from tea ceremony architecture, this style emphasizes understated elegance, texture, and the deliberate passage of time.
Sukiya-style architecture is defined by the use of natural, unadorned materials, such as wood, bamboo, and earthen walls, designed to create a sense of harmony with the environment. Unlike more ornate architectural forms, the sukiya aesthetic prioritizes spatial balance and the subtle interplay of light and shadow over decorative excess. According to historical architectural analysis, the style evolved from the tea room (chashitsu) aesthetic, which values the concept of wabi-sabi—finding beauty in imperfection and the natural aging process (Architectural Digest, 2024).
The Japanese philosophy of teioku ichinyo, or "harmony between the house and garden as one," requires that the structure and the landscape be designed as a single, unified entity. To achieve this, you must prioritize sightlines that draw the eye from the interior to specific focal points in the garden. For example, in the restoration of historic Kyoto residences, master gardeners and architects coordinate the placement of trees and stone features to the millimeter, ensuring that the view from key interior vantage points remains unobstructed and balanced (Ueyakato Landscape, 2024).
Preserving the patina—the surface changes caused by age, oxidation, and wear—is a core tenet of Japanese residential design because it marks the passage of time and anchors a home in its history. Rather than replacing worn surfaces, the sukiya approach encourages maintenance that respects the original character of materials like mud walls, weathered timber, and hand-hewn stone. This approach shifts the definition of luxury away from the "shiny and new" toward a deeper appreciation for craftsmanship and material longevity (NAP Architectural Design Office, 2024).
Renovating a historic property requires a balance between modern utility and the preservation of original architectural intent. When updating a structure for modern living, focus on "invisible" infrastructure that does not alter the building's footprint or exterior appearance. Common upgrades include installing underfloor heating or climate control systems within existing floor cavities, which allows you to maintain the aesthetic integrity of the original wood and plaster finishes while meeting contemporary comfort standards. Always consult local heritage regulations, as many historic regions restrict structural expansions to protect the area's cultural fabric.
Executing a project that respects traditional craftsmanship requires hiring specialists who possess deep knowledge of regional building techniques. For projects involving historic Japanese aesthetics, this often means working with firms that have multigenerational experience in carpentry and landscape maintenance. Look for practitioners who prioritize the repair of original joinery over wholesale replacement. By engaging with professionals who understand the specific vernacular of the region, you ensure that the project remains authentic to its historical context while functioning for modern use. The success of a renovation often hinges on the coordination between the architect, the landscape designer, and the lead carpenter from the initial planning stages, rather than treating these as separate disciplines.
